Private IP Address: These are used inside a network, for example, a home network that is used by tablets, Wi-Fi cameras, wireless printers, and desktop PCs. These types of IP addresses provide a way for devices to communicate with a router and the other devices on the private home network.Private IP addresses can be set manually or assigned automatically by the router.

5 Examples of a Private Network - Simplicable A private network is a network that is isolated from the internet and other public networks. The following are common examples. Office Network Office networks are commonly private in that devices on the network can't be viewed from the outside. In most cases, outbound internet connections are allowed but these connections are restricted.
